Dubai, United Arab Emirates, 18th September 2013- Panasonic Marketing Middle East & Africa, showcased its comprehensive line-up of industry leading total business solutions, at its first ever Systems Solutions Exhibition in Africa.

Panasonic's has high-end industry solutions are tailored specifically to meet the needs of regional businesses, and support the diverse industry verticals across the African continent.

Held at the scenic and beautiful Safari Park Hotel in Nairobi, Kenya, the event was attended by Panasonic's key business partners from the African continent, along with Panasonic representatives, comprising of Mr. Yorihisa Shiokawa, Managing Director, Panasonic Asia Pacific, and Mr. Masao Motoki, Managing Director, Panasonic Marketing Middle East & Africa.

Products showcased at the exhibition comprised of Panasonic's business solutions like telephones, faxes, office automation solutions, educational solutions like Panaboards, High definition communication solutions, network and analog products, home security products, batteries and lamps, air conditioners, and a host of eco solutions like ventilating and ceiling fan, and air purifiers.

Panasonic plans to actively promote and create new business-to-business (B2B) and business-to-governments (B2G) opportunities in Africa, while continuing to sustain its products in the traditional B2C business sphere.

Currently, Panasonic is aggressively working towards expanding its reach and enhancing customer touch points across the Middle East & Africa. As part of providing a direct service network, Panasonic has already established representative offices across Africa, including Kenya, Angola, Nigeria, Egypt, and South Africa.

In parallel to the representative offices, Panasonic is also planning to open signature stores like the Panasonic Plaza's across the continent. The Panasonic Plaza's are set to serve as a one-stop destination for all the consumers. Currently, Panasonic Plaza is already operational in Kenya and Nigeria.

Panasonic plans to add 100 more service centers to the already existing line-up of 597 service centers across the Middle East & Africa (MEA) by March 2015.

About Panasonic
Panasonic Corporation is a worldwide leader in the development and engineering of electronic technologies and solutions for customers in residential, non-residential, mobility and personal applications. Since its founding in 1918, the company has expanded globally and now operates over 500 consolidated companies worldwide, recording consolidated net sales of 7.30 trillion yen for the year ended March 31, 2013. Committed to pursuing new value through innovation across divisional lines, the company strives to create a better life and a better world for its customers.

About Panasonic Marketing Middle East and Africa FZE (PMMAF)
Effective January 1, 2012.Panasonic Marketing Middle East FZE (PMM) has been renamed as 'Panasonic Marketing Middle East and Africa FZE' (PMMAF). As the regional Headquarters, all functions related to Sales and Marketing, Supply chain and Customer service solutions, and Advertising functions under the brand name Panasonic is handled by PMMAF.
